Ria Financial's money transfer fees can vary based on several factors, including the specific service selected, the amount being sent, the destination country, and the method of payment. Generally, Ria offers competitive fees compared to other money transfer services, ensuring that customers can send money affordably while still maintaining efficient service.
When using Ria to send money, customers often have the option to pay using various methods, such as bank transfers, debit cards, or credit cards, which can also impact the fee structure. Transfers sent to different countries or regions may incur different fees, as various international regulations and exchange rates come into play.
In addition to transaction fees, customers should also be aware of potential exchange rates applicable to their transfer, as these can affect the total amount that the recipient ultimately receives. For the most accurate and current fee information, it is advisable to visit Ria's official website, where customers can access a fee calculator and obtain detailed information tailored to their specific needs. This will ensure clarity regarding all costs involved in the money transfer process.
